Output 08d395a8c28a19a68c1500a6c8f3c759a0d9a6f36dc43e95b60c99eabcb0bd6e:0

value
3443000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5faf5fd8c328cca1b7685633d8cc9785eb298aa9 OP_EQUALVERIFY OP_CHECKSIG
address
19iwHT9sPY4PvKJADFwfgGPsRhmRohhkpb
transaction
08d395a8c28a19a68c1500a6c8f3c759a0d9a6f36dc43e95b60c99eabcb0bd6e
spent
true